Description
The squid giant synapse has historically been the best model for investigating synaptic transmission. This book, by one of the leading workers on synaptic transmission, gives a concise overview of all that has been learned about synaptic transmission in its most standard model system. The book also contains a computer model, entitled "Synapse", usable in PC and Macintosh, that allows the reader to simulate and manipulate any aspect of synaptic transmission. The disc contains two programs: the research modelling tool for working neuroscientists; and a drylab to teach students the principles of synaptic transmission by allowing them to alter the parameters, essentially without limits, and see the effects on the ation potential over time in milliseconds. The book is intended for lecturers to use in graduate and undergraduate courses on synaptic transmission and the physiology of neurons and excitable cells.
